Nvidia’s Market Capitalization Soars by $200 Billion in Overnight Trading

Nvidia's market capitalization soared by $200 billion overnight on the back of strong revenue growth projections and increased AI chip production, cementing its position as a prominent player in the tech industry.

Nvidia’s Market Capitalization: In a remarkable turn of events, Nvidia Corp, the renowned chipmaker, experienced an astonishing surge in its market capitalization (m-cap) overnight. The company’s stock price skyrocketed by 24.37% in a single day, propelling its market value by a staggering $200 billion. This meteoric rise was driven by Nvidia’s projection of robust revenue growth and its efforts to ramp up production of AI chips to meet the escalating demand.

Nvidia’s Market Capitalization Surge

The overnight trading session witnessed an extraordinary surge in Nvidia’s stock, which surged by an impressive 28% to reach a historic high of $391.50 per share. As a result, the company’s market value crossed the $960 billion mark, positioning Nvidia as the fifth-most valuable company on Wall Street. By the end of the trading day, the stock closed at $379.80 per share, leading to a market capitalization of $939.29 billion, up from $755.24 billion in the previous session. April Quarter Earnings and Conference Call

Nvidia recently reported its earnings for the April quarter and hosted a conference call on May 24th. During the call, the company provided guidance for the upcoming quarter, projecting particularly strong quarter-on-quarter revenue growth in July. This optimistic outlook is primarily driven by the surging demand for AI, which has become a key driver of Nvidia’s success.

Nvidia’s Market CapitalizationAnalyst Insights

According to Nomura, a leading financial services group, Nvidia’s July quarter outlook indicates that the recovery in chip demand from US cloud server providers commenced earlier than anticipated. The firm notes that Nvidia’s PC-related (gaming) sales exhibited quarter-on-quarter growth in the April quarter. Furthermore, Nomura suggests that Nvidia’s overall sales guidance, which is exceptionally strong, implies continued quarter-on-quarter growth in the July quarter.

Market Analyst Commentary

Edward Moya, Senior Market Analyst at The Americas OANDA, highlights Nvidia’s AI boom as a driving force behind its climb in the tech industry. He asserts that Nvidia is becoming a must-own stock for investors and suggests that the days of discussing FAANG have evolved into MATANA. Moya predicts that Nvidia is poised to become a trillion-dollar company, especially as the chipmaker plans for a substantial increase in the second half of the year.

The robust orders for data centers are seen as an excellent starting point for what could be an extraordinary 10-year cycle. Second-quarter sales are anticipated to reach $11 billion with a margin of ±2%, surpassing the consensus estimate of $7.18 billion. As cloud-based AI investments gain traction, Nvidia’s role in enabling this technological advancement becomes increasingly vital.
